The combined elasticity of the upper edge portions of the front and rear-and-side parts of the panty may be suflicient as a means for maintaining the panty in proper position about the body of the wearer. When not in position upon the body of the wearer, the upper edge portion of the front part 1 may naturally roll upon itself as a reserve; but, when in normal position upon the body of the wearer, this rolled edge portion may be unrolled so as to extend upwardly over and about the enlarged abdomen of the wearers body in a somewhat peaked manner as illustrated in Fig. 3 of the accompanying drawing.
Within the seams between the front part 1 and the side portions 2a of the rear-and-side part I have provided the longitudinally elastic narrow strips 8 which will serve still further to hold the garment in upright position especially as the front part 1 is extended upwardly during the advancing stages of pregnancy. Both the front part 1 and the side portions 2a will be gathered along the elastic strips 8 throughout the entire extent thereof so as to permit the strips 8 to function in the manner intended; and there will be provided still further fulnexs in the upper portion of the front part 1 and in the lower portion of the rear-and-side part 22a even when the elastic strips 8 have been stretched to the full extent permitted. Thus the up-and-down elasticity that is afforded by the strips 8 supplement the horizontal elasticity of the front part 1 and the rear-and-side part 22a and of the elastic strip 7 in maintaining the garment in proper position upon the body of the wearer during the progressive stages of pregnancy.
Since the front part 1 in the region below the strip is adapted for snug engagement about and beneath the abdomen of the body of the wearer at all times during the period of pregnancy and Without any such additional fulness as above referred to, the lower portion of the front part 1 will co-operate with the elastic strip 5 in providing an uplifting or supporting elfect beneath the undersurface of the abdomen of the wearers body. As above noted, the lower portion of the rear-and-side part 22a is provided with added fulness even when the elastic strips 8 have been stretched to their full extent and is gathered about the elastic strips at the leg openings, such fulness and elasticity facilitating the manipulation of the rear part of the panty for personal use.
Thus I have devised a panty with effective and comfortable means of support about the waist portion of the body of the wearer and with a marked degree of elfective uplifting engagement beneath the lower part of the wearers abdomen so as to produce a combined supporting engagement for the panty about the abdominal region of the body of the wearer.
Also, there is provided suitable fullness in the front part of the panty for accommodation of the enlarged abdomen during all stages of the period of pregnancy; While at the same time the lower front part of the panty is adapted to co-operate with the special means for the uplifting engagement beneath the abdomen of the wearer. This panty may be put on or taken ofi by the wearer with utmost convenience by virtue of the combined elasticity, as above described, in spite of the abnormally enlarged contour of the abdominal region of the wearers body during the period of pregnancy.
The comfort in the wearing of this panty is still further enhanced by the provision of the leg-shielding portions to prevent chafing or binding in the region of the crotch of the wearer.
With the effective engagement of the elastic strip 5 and the lower portion of the front part 1 beneath the abdomen of the wearer, there will be ensured proper position of the panty upon the wearers body whether or not garters and stockings are Worn; and thus the wearing of stockings with this improved form of panty is entirely a matter of choice upon the part of the wearer. Such proper positioning of the panty at all times and under any and all conditions is further ensured by the elasticity afforded by the strips 8 in the seams between the front part 1 and the side portions 2a.

What I claim is:
1. A panty comprising a rear-and-side part of laterally elastic soft fabric, a front part of laterally elastic fabric that is heavier than said rear-and-side part and that is joined thereto along lines corresponding approximately to the groins of the body of the wearer and that extends upwardly to the waist region of her body, a crotch part of soft fabric connected at its ends to said rear-and-side part and said front part, respectively, and providing therewith leg openings, and a longitudinally elastic strip of substantial width attached throughout its length to the inner surface of said front part and extending laterally across the lower abdominal-covering portion of the panty and above the bottom of said front part thereof so as to afford an uplifting engagement beneath the abdomen of the wearer, and the adjacent portions of said crotch and rear-and-side parts being extended downwardly with the seams therebetween adapted to extend downwardly along the upper parts of the wearers thighs so as to thereby provide shielding portions for the inner parts of the wearers legs in the region of her crotch.
2. A panty comprising a rear-and-side part of laterally elastic fabric, a front part of laterally elastic fabric that is joined to said rear-and-side part along lines corresponding to the groins of the body of the wearer and extending upwardly to a point corresponding to the waist region of her body, and a crotch part of substantial width throughout its entire extent having its front and rear ends attached to said front and rear-and-side parts, respectively, the adjacent portions of said crotch and rear-andside parts that correspond to the inner sides of the wearers legs extending downwardly substantially below the crotch so as to provide downwardly extending legshielding portions for the inner parts of the wearers legs in the region of the crotch of her body.
